中文摘要 | T(i)3Al(1-x)Si(x)C(2) solid solutions exhibited abnormal high coefficients of thermal expansion at temperatures of > 940 degrees C during heating, which was ascribed to the precipitation of Si as Ti5Si3. Ti5Si3 phase usually located at the grain boundaries of the solid solutions. (c) 2006 Acta Materialia Inc. Published by Elsevier Ltd. All rights reserved. |
